Microsoft to Update Windows Phone to Apollo on June 20 (Rumors)

Will the major update of Windows Phone (8.0, code named Apollo) will be the focal point of the Windows Phone Summit by Microsoft in San Francisco on June 20?

Now, Microsoft is extending the invitations through the ‘Windows Phone site’ for the event at San Francisco which is expected to revolve around ‘A Sneak Peak of the Future of Windows Phone.

As the officials at Redmond are arriving in San Francisco, we hope to have a close look at the next mobile OS by windows Phone. Remember, BlackBerry 10 was revealed last month, Microsoft officials must be naturally concerned with the new updates in the Windows Phone.
